Come back.
The coffee is ready; please come back.
By the way, I watered the plants and I changed the sand of the cat.
I need you to return me the books that I lent you.
Oh, I also rent a movie... We can watch it together if you come back.
Please; darling, come back. This is hurting me in the bones, in the sheets of the bed andΒ Β in the cigarettes we used to smoke.
Come on, you know I'm very bad at writing. When you read this you probably don't want to come back.
Come back and ***** my life; please come back.
